Maui Canoe Club is a well-known and highly regarded organization that promotes the sport of canoe racing and perpetuates the Hawaiian culture. With its rich history and strong community presence, Maui Canoe Club has become a staple in the Maui community. Whether you're a seasoned paddler or just starting out, Maui Canoe Club offers something for everyone.
One of the pain points that many people face when it comes to joining a canoe club is finding a welcoming and inclusive community. Maui Canoe Club addresses this by creating a supportive environment where individuals of all ages and skill levels can come together to learn, grow, and compete. They understand the importance of fostering a sense of belonging and camaraderie within the club.
The main goal of Maui Canoe Club is to provide opportunities for individuals to participate in the sport of canoe racing and connect with the Hawaiian culture. They offer various programs and events throughout the year, including races, clinics, and cultural workshops. By engaging in these activities, members have the chance to develop their paddling skills, gain a deeper understanding of the history and traditions of Hawaiian canoeing, and forge lifelong friendships.
